在当今的软件开发领域,跨平台应用开发变得越来越受欢迎。JavaScript(JS)作为一种轻量级、功能强大的编程语言,成为了实现跨平台应用的关键。通过编写JS SDK,开发者可以轻松地将应用部署到多个平台,如Web、iOS和Android。本文将详细介绍如何轻松学会编写JS SDK,并一步到位打造跨平台应用解决方案。
一、了解JS SDK
1.1 什么是JS SDK?
JS SDK,即JavaScript软件开发工具包,是一组用于开发、测试和部署JavaScript应用程序的工具和库。它通常包括API、文档、示例代码等,旨在帮助开发者快速构建跨平台应用。
1.2 JS SDK的优势
- 跨平台:JS SDK支持多个平台,如Web、iOS和Android,使得开发者可以节省时间和资源。
- 易于使用:JavaScript语法简单,易于学习和掌握。
- 丰富的库和框架:JavaScript拥有丰富的库和框架,如jQuery、React、Vue等,可以帮助开发者快速开发。
二、学习编写JS SDK
2.1 熟悉JavaScript基础
在开始编写JS SDK之前,你需要掌握JavaScript的基础知识,包括变量、数据类型、运算符、函数、对象等。
2.2 学习模块化和组件化
模块化和组件化是现代JavaScript开发的重要概念。通过将代码分解成模块和组件,可以提高代码的可读性、可维护性和可复用性。
2.3 掌握API设计
API是JS SDK的核心,设计良好的API可以方便开发者使用你的SDK。在设计API时,需要注意以下几点:
- 简洁明了:API命名要简洁明了,易于理解。
- 遵循规范:遵循一定的命名规范,如驼峰命名法。
- 文档齐全:提供详细的API文档,包括使用方法、参数说明、示例代码等。
2.4 使用构建工具
构建工具可以帮助你自动化构建过程,提高开发效率。常见的构建工具有Webpack、Gulp等。
三、打造跨平台应用解决方案
3.1 使用JS SDK
将JS SDK集成到你的应用中,可以通过以下步骤:
- 引入JS SDK文件。
- 初始化SDK。
- 调用SDK提供的API。
3.2 集成原生平台
为了在原生平台上运行JS SDK,你需要使用相应的桥接技术,如Cordova、React Native等。
3.3 测试和优化
在开发过程中,要不断测试和优化你的JS SDK,确保其在不同平台上的性能和稳定性。
四、总结
通过学习编写JS SDK,你可以轻松打造跨平台应用解决方案。掌握JavaScript基础、模块化和组件化、API设计等知识,以及使用构建工具和桥接技术,将有助于你实现这一目标。希望本文能为你提供有益的参考。
